Matawalle Reacts to Resignations of Commissioners, Aides

Zamfara Governor, Bello Matawalle has reacted to the resignation of the state’s commissioner of Education, Jamilu Zannah, the State Commissioner for Science and Technology, Bilyaminu Shinkafi and the Governor’s Special Adviser on Comprehensive Agricultural Revolution Programme, Sambo Marafa.

Speaking on the reason tendered by Zannah to resign, the governor described as unfortunate and said he was planning to score a cheap political goal.

Matawalle, who is currently on a foreign trip reacted through his Special Adviser on Media, Zailani Bappa.

The governor said he could not understand why “someone who claims closeness to His Excellency will resort to this unwholesome antic which is clearly a ploy to achieve a cheap and personal political goal.”

He, therefore, dismissed the reasons for the resignation as paltry, shallow and a political joke.

Matawalle, however, wished Zannah all the best in his future endeavors.

According to reports, Shinkafi left the state executive council to take up an appointment as a member of the National Assembly Commission, while Marafa, a younger brother of the former lawmaker representing Zamfara Central, Kabir Marafa, went back to focus on his private business.
